???????????????????? ???????????????????????????????????? ???????????????????????????????? ????????????????????????????????????????? ?????????????????????????????????????????????????????? ???????????? ?????????????????????????? ???????????????? ????????????????????????????????????????????????????? ???????????????????????????????????????????????????